Output 2ecacd72b8b13ba722e0831d9491e608b7a4ad4ba9585dd36da8e0ae0585f43a:0

value
754600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ef6f60e6e4378f3b29a7550c557cf6e105297be1 OP_EQUAL
address
3PX2r79883sXsSvSJWdztNm5FgNS9RebM9
transaction
2ecacd72b8b13ba722e0831d9491e608b7a4ad4ba9585dd36da8e0ae0585f43a
spent
true